Assessment and Containment
Our team will arrive at your home and assess the damage to find out the extent of the water damage. We’ll identify the source of the leak and contain the affected area to prevent further water from entering your home. This step is crucial in preventing secondary damage and saving you money.
Water Removal
Next, our team will use specialized equipment to remove the standing water from your home. We’ll use pumps and extractors to quickly remove the water, and then use desiccant machines to dry the affected areas.
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water is removed, our team will use specialized equipment to dry your home thoroughly. We’ll use desiccant machines and subfloors drying equipment to ensure that all surfaces are dry and free from moisture.
Final Inspection and Clean-up
After the drying process is complete, our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that all surfaces are dry and free from moisture. We’ll also clean and disinfect the affected areas to prevent any further damage or health risks.

Leaking Pipe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ak under the sink | Yes | No | DIY is fine for small leaks under the sink. You can use a wet/dry vacuum to remove the water and some towels to dry the area. |
| Large leak in the basement | No | Yes | A large leak in the basement needs specialized equipment and expertise to handle. Don’t risk further damage or health risks by trying to tackle it yourself. |
| Water damage from a burst pipe | No | Yes | When a pipe bursts, water damage can spread quickly. Don’t wait; call a professional right away to contain the damage and start the drying process. |
| Musty odors in the home | No | Yes | Musty odors in the home can be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ore these odors; call a professional to identify and remove the source of the problem. |
| Warped or buckled flooring | No | Yes | Warped or buckled flooring is a sign of water damage. Don’t risk further damage or health risks by trying to repair it yourself. Call a professional to assess and repair the damage. |

Leaking Pipe Water Removal Cost in Woodinville, WA
The cost of Leaking Pipe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Woodinville, WA. These are estimates; your final price will depend on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ates for your convenience.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Containment |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area and severity of damage |
| Water Removal | $1,000 – $5,000 | Amount of water and equipment needed |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,500 – $6,000 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ed |
| Final Inspection and Clean-up | $500 – $2,000 | Severity of damage and type of clean-up needed |
